About This Item
Edmonton, Alberta: University of Alberta Press, 1986. 1st Edition . Hardcover. Fine/Fine. Heavy 8vo. 2 Volumes. Each volume signed on the half title page by the translator, George Woodcock.632 pgs. & 729 pgs. Bibliography. Photo plates and maps. A trace of creasing to the dust jackets at the top of spines, else fine. "Giraud's well-regarded & detailed history of the Metis and their role in the development of western Canada".
